94 needs to start the ONE "official attendance issues" post and it will probably run several hundred pages by the end of the season.

One additional comment I haven't heard form anyone...relating to keeping this all in perspective:

SMU claims roughly 10,000 students and we play in a stadium 3 times that size that we can't fill. Relatively speaking, how do the the larger public schools compare? Texas has close to 50,000 students but they don't have 150,000 seats (the question is whether they could fill those seats when they play an opponent that brings very few fans?) If our stadium had the same roughly 1.5 to 1 ratio of stadium seats to students as many of the big boys do, we'd have a 15k stadium and I dare say we could fill it with our own fans for most, if not all games

USC does better because there is no NFL in LA and for a long time USC was the defacto pro team. Miami does ok because they have a 30 years of success inluding national championships, I would be curious how they are doing now in attendance as they start to falter. TCU has had 6 10 win season and are just now getting to the point of consistant sell outs how were they doing attendance wise 6 years ago?
